#899644 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#899644 is composed of 53.7% red, 58.8%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 69.5 degrees, a saturation of 37.6% and a lightness of 42.7%. #899644 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#132d00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#899644 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#899644 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#899644 has RGB values of R:137, G:150,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9016900.

Shades and Tints of #899644
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f9faf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#899644
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727466 is the less saturated color, while #b7d901 is the most saturated one.
